How did Legalism influence Chinese society during its dynastic era?

Legalism influenced the Chinese society during its dynastic era because it prescribed harsh penalties for any minor crime. Legalism was a belief the ancient China people had that humans were able to do more wrong than right. Because they were only motivated by things that for were for self gain.
